Thaulsis Posted October 18, 2005 Share Posted October 18, 2005 I wouldn't have so much an issue of having combat skills going to 120, it is just why stop at just combat skills? There is a handful of other stats, and not everyone just trains combat. Why not make say woodcutting, firemaking and fletching go to 120 and leave the rest? I could just see a huge headache for Jagex after they just make combat skills go that high. People would want cooking up there to provide food for the combat. Runecrafters would want their level increased so they could better provide runes. Fletchers to provide better arrows and bows. Herblorists to provide the potions. Then once those are raised then of course their complementary skills would have to go up too. Others would complain that it is not fair that person X has level 120 attack level, while they have more xp in fletching but are only level 99. I dunno, It just seems that they should throw all the skills up that high but don't necessarily have new things they can do at that high a level. Most of the Skills already don't have any new things you can do in the high levels anyways. Also what would happen to the high level NPCs? There is high level monsters that drop expensive items now because there is some difficulty killing them. With the Kalphite Queen for example, a new maxed out with all 120s, could easily solo her over and over, numerous times a trip. While if you increase her level to compensate for this then the people that were fighting her before without raising their combat stats would find killing her a lot more difficult then before. Fix these problems and i'd be all for the increase. Link to comment Share on other sites More sharing options...
